Styles and Features of Rustic Wooden Coffee Tables
Types of Wood:
- Reclaimed Wood: Often sourced from old barns, sheds, or even bridges, reclaimed wood adds a historical touch and sustainability to your decor.
- Salvaged Logs: Rustic coffee tables made from salvaged logs offer a unique, natural, and organic look. The natural bark and branches often remain intact, adding to their appeal.
- Repurposed Barn Wood: Barn wood with its weathered and distressed appearance creates a charming and rustic feel.
Design Elements:
- Live Edge: Leaving the natural edge of the wood exposed creates a visually stunning and organic look.
- Distressed Finish: This technique adds character and a sense of history to the table.
- Metal Accents: Incorporating metal legs, brackets, or hardware adds a modern touch to the rustic design.

Caring for Your Rustic Wooden Coffee Table
- Regular Dusting: Dust the table regularly with a soft cloth to prevent the accumulation of dirt.
- Protect from Moisture: Avoid placing hot or wet items directly on the table. Use coasters to prevent watermarks and heat damage.
- Avoid Harsh Cleaners: Use mild soap and water to clean the table.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age the wood finish.
